ENSEMBLE WORK SAMPLE

INSTRUCTIONS

The CD-R Work Sample should represent the recorded work that best demonstrates the artistic excellence of the Ensemble.

·  Submit three to five tracks, totaling no more than 30 minutes in duration on one CD-R.

·  Excerpts from full compositions are acceptable.

·  If working with a guest artist(s), please submit samples of his/her work on up to two of

the tracks.

·  Commercially released material is allowable but must be re-recorded on the CD-R.

·  Live, studio, and “home” recordings are acceptable. Sound quality is not judged

but generally affects perception.

The ensemble performing on the work sample does not have to be identical in size or membership to that listed on the application, but it should be representative of the group for which funding is requested. The program recognizes that individual members and group size may vary over time, but an ongoing core of musicians should remain the same.

Past New Works: Creation and Presentation Program Grantees

If applying for additional funding to present a past New Works: Creation and Presentation Program grantee ensemble performing its previously commissioned piece, the first track must be a portion or movement of the commissioned work.

Tracks and Labeling

·  Record each work on a separate track.

·  Mark track information on the CD-R itself, as well as on the insert.

·  Label each track clearly with the following information:

Name and instrument of each ensemble member

Title of work performed

Use CD-Rs only

DVDs, cassette or DAT tapes, mini-discs, videotapes, or commercially packaged CDs are not accepted.

NOTE: Please test ALL of the tracks on a standard CD player.

Applications with unplayable CDs will be disqualified.
